Electrical Essentials

The Spark of Innovation. Understanding the invisible force that powers our world through safe, hands-on experiments.

Course Modules
1

Module 1: The Circuit Loop

Power Sources, Conductors vs Insulators, Closed Loops

2

Module 2: Controlling Flow

Switches, Push Buttons, Buzzers

3

Module 3: Series & Parallel

Voltage Stacking, Load Distribution, Troubleshooting

Key Outcome

Students build their first functional circuits, understanding continuity, power sources, and basic control.

Projects
Paper Circuits
Copper tape and LED art projects.
Steady Hand Game
Classic wire loop game requiring circuit continuity.
